It’s about time for a Sisters party!
Saturday, February 17th, the Sisters in Sound and ‘ohana will take over Lotus Soundbar. It’s Chinese New Year, and we can think of no better way to bring luck and prosperity in 2007 than with female djs, hot tunes, and several hundred of our closest friends. Can you?
All the way from San Francisco, DJ Zita will be returning! And with her, she’s bringing her partner on the decks, Dmadness. Together Zita and Dmadness hold down U.N.I.T.Y. every second Friday at Duplex in San Francisco. Their unique blend of “soul, funk, disco, electro, afrobeat, soulful house, roots&culture, dancehall, and classic jams from past and future eras” will be sure to keep the heads bobbin’ and booties shakin’! And you know SIS is all about the booty shakin…
Our brothers on the decks, DJ K-ing (Freeform Sound Collective, Lotus Soundbar), Monkey (Electrolyfe), and Seeko (Direct Descendants, W) will be on hand to bring some funk and flavor of their own. It’s been too long since Seeko has played at an SIS party and we’re very excited to have him back.
We’re also very excited about the venue for this party. Lotus Soundbar is a brand new space which opened in December. Thanks to the musical guidance of Ramyt and Paul Shih, it’s shaping up to be the most exciting new spot for solid music in Waikiki. With three rooms of rhythm and a great bar staff, Lotus also has three floors of space to dance, meet new friends, and catch up with old ones. This space definitely has that “it” factor. If you haven’t seen it yet, the SIS party could be the excuse you’ve been waiting for!
